Quick Comparison at a Glance

CriteriaVietnamGeorgia
Annual Tuition Fee₹5-5.5 lakhs₹5-6 lakhs
Total 6-Year Cost₹30-33 lakhs₹30-36 lakhs
Course Duration6 years (including internship)6 years
Medium of InstructionEnglishEnglish
RecognitionNMC, WHO, WFMENMC, WHO, WFME
Safety Rating8/108/10
Food AvailabilityGoodAverage
ClimateTropical (Hot & Humid in South, Cool winters in North)Temperate (Cold winters, mild summers)
Visa ProcessEasyEasy
Indian Students2,0005,000
FMGE Pass Rate75-85%70-80%
ROI Score9/107/10

Pros & Cons Comparison

Vietnam

Advantages

  • Extremely affordable - 60% cheaper than Indian private colleges
  • NMC and WHO recognized universities
  • English medium instruction
  • Practical training from Day 1
  • Low cost of living (₹15,000-20,000/month)
  • Safe and welcoming country for Indian students
  • High-quality education with modern facilities
  • Growing destination with 2,000+ Indian students

Disadvantages

  • Language barrier outside campus (Vietnamese)
  • Relatively new destination compared to Russia/China
  • Limited direct flights from smaller Indian cities
  • Hot and humid climate in southern regions

Georgia

Advantages

  • European country - EU standards
  • English medium throughout
  • No entrance exam required
  • Beautiful country with rich history
  • Safe and peaceful
  • Growing destination for Indian students

Disadvantages

  • Higher fees than Russia/China
  • Language barrier outside campus (Georgian)
  • Limited Indian food options
  • Political tension with neighboring Russia
  • Cold winters
  • Relatively unknown destination
